Working Principles

The S2010DRP operates on the principle of rectification, allowing current to flow in only one direction. When a positive voltage is applied to the anode with respect to the cathode, the diode conducts, allowing current to flow. Conversely, when a negative voltage is applied, the diode blocks the current flow.
